Conditions

Health Condition 1: K088- Other specified disorders of teethand supporting structures

Interventions

Intervention1: Class II elastic Ormco: Class II elastic Ormco - wear for 24hrs and measure force degradation Control Intervention1: Class II elastic American Orthodontics: Class II elastic American Or

Sponsors

Dr Jagruti Patil
Lead Sponsor

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Patients who are undergoing fixed orthodontic treatment Patients whose treatment needed intermaxillary class 2 elastics

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Periodontally compromised patients. Patient allergic to latex Patients having a habit of smoking

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
To evaluate the force degradation of 3/16 latex elastics of group A (American orthodontics elastics) and group B (Ormco elastics) at three intervals.Timepoint: 48 hours

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
To compare force degradation between the groups.Timepoint: 48 hours
